Mr. Dargan Fitzgerald:

Well, I would just repeat that the ... and the comment we've made that you refer to is at the, I might say, the highest possible level. It looks at and comments on our general understanding of whether processes of internal control are operating effectively. In the work that we carried out, we found that internal control environment to be relatively strong. And when I say that, we would be comparing to the experience we had had of other similar institutions and to other institutions generally. I do feel there was a strong control consciousness.

Now, notwithstanding that, banking involves dealings with an enormous number of individual customers and the Financial Regulator's brief, I believe, in carrying out reviews like this is to highlight procedural matters that would not have the same significance for us as for the regulator.
